Alexander Aizman has authored 9 papers that have received a total of 856 indexed citations.
This includes 7 papers in Ophthalmology, 2 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 1 paper in Molecular Biology. The topics of these papers are Retinal and Optic Conditions (5 papers), Retinal Diseases and Treatments (5 papers) and Glaucoma and retinal disorders (3 papers). Alexander Aizman is often cited by papers focused on Retinal and Optic Conditions (5 papers), Retinal Diseases and Treatments (5 papers) and Glaucoma and retinal disorders (3 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United States and Brazil. Alexander Aizman's co-authors include Nicole Groß, Lawrence A. Yannuzzi, James M. Klancnik, A J Brucker and Richard F. Spaide and has published in prestigious journals such as Ophthalmology, Investigative Ophthalmology & Visual Science and Retina.
